you will want to go under the NAT tab and set a new portforward to a specific address to a specific service to your internal network. Make sure that the check box at the bottom of the screen is set to auto creat a rule for incoming request on this new entry. If you need more specific help on how to protforward to your internal web server, let me know. Also don't forget that you can also do 1-to-1 NAT if you have more than 1 public IP.
